Hi all — quick note from the front desk at Aldermoor House. The cleaning crew from BrightSpan Services comes through every weekday evening from 18:30, so don't be startled if you're working late and hear the vacuums. They're cleared for all open-plan areas but not the meeting pods, so please don't prop those doors. If you need to let a cleaner back in through the east stairwell after hours, use this door code.

staff pass of kawep-hahap = bdg-IEUUF-6

FAQ: What do I do when the intern cohort arrives?

Every spring the Oakmere office gets a wave of interns, and the facilities desk fields the same questions. Short version: they gather in the atrium, HR escorts them up in groups, and temporary passes get printed on arrival. If the printer jams (it will), hand out the backup passes using the code below.

staff pass of kagup-fajog = bdg-QCHVQW-99665837

## Session Handling for Health Checks

The Corvel gateway sits behind the Lanternside load balancer, which probes /healthz every ten seconds. Health-check requests are stateless by design: they bypass the session store entirely so that probe traffic never inflates session counts or evicts real user sessions. New team members should note that the deep-check endpoint, /healthz/deep, does verify session-store connectivity and therefore requires authentication. When probing it manually, supply the token below.

bearer token for tajep-kajef: eyJhbGciOiJIUzI1NiIsInR5cCI6IkpXVCJ9.eyJzdWIiOiIoOsZ23In0.CsygO0hs

Exportron's spreadsheet export streams rows instead of buffering the full workbook, capping memory at ~150MB per job. Release managers: watch the `export_heap_peak` metric after each deploy; regressions usually mean someone reintroduced eager sheet loading. Exports over 500k rows route to the batch tier automatically. Release artifacts must be signed with the key below.

deploy key for kajof-fajop: bky6_gDHw9Q